White HP TouchPad 64GB now available in France with dual-core 1.5GHz
Coming fresh off some embarrassing rumors about Best Buy seeking a refund on its original TouchPad, HP has just released a new and improved model in the country of France. The new pad has been seen on the company’s French site, sporting 64GB of storage, a dual-core 1.5GHz Qualcomm Snapdragon APQ8060, a painted white back cover, and a €599 ($864) price tag.
According to Pre Central, HP has informed them that this new version of the TouchPad will be rolling out across Europe, Middle East and Africa regions. Unfortunately, we still cannot say with absolute certainty whether the white HP TouchPad will ever set foot on US soil or not.
But being the first tablet to ship with two cores clocked at 1.5GHz, is a feat worth acknowledging. Hopefully, with a newer variant of the original TouchPad, the company can make a comeback away from a cesspool of negative press.
